Crear una macro para Microsoft Access a través de interoperabilidad

¿Es posible crear una nueva macro usando C # usando la biblioteca Interop en Microsoft Access de manera similar a Word, Excel o PowerPoint? En las otras aplicaciones, tienes acceso aMicrosoft.Vbe.Interop._VBComponent, que te permite inyectar nuevas macros, a través de laDocument, WorksheetoPresentation clases No parece que Access tenga nada parecido a esto. El acceso tiene unAllMacros lista, pero parece ser de sólo lectura. Sé cómo ejecutar la macro una vez que está en el proyecto, pero necesito poder agregar macros dinámicamente. Apreciaría mucho a cualquier persona que me pueda indicar la dirección correcta.

Respuestas a la pregunta(2)

Su respuesta a la pregunta